What Happened

Pride Mobility Products Corp. is recalling Quantum 4Front 2 powered wheelchairs because if the "Remind Me Later" option is selected for user reminders, reminder pop-up messages may appear while the wheelchair is in use. If this occurs while driving the wheelchair, the wheelchair may perform an unexpected park brake stop, which may result in fall or injury. If this occurs while not driving the wheelchair, the control system may crash and remain in pre-operational mode.

Which Products Are Affected

The recall involves 1,102 units of Brand Name: Quantum Rehab, Product Name: Quantum 4Front 2, Model/Catalog Number: Quantum 4Front 2, Software Version: 2.0.11 (new version: 2.0.13). Product Description: Wheelchair, Powered (ITI), 890.3860, Component: Controller. Lot Code: Quantum 4Front 2 0060650920019*6 K143383 D246699 41875 ITI. Distribution is worldwide, including US nationwide in AZ, NJ, PA, OK, CO, IN, AR, KS, CT, MD, WI, TX, FL, WA, NY, MO, LA, UT, OR, VA, RI, CA, TN, MN, KY, NV, GA, WV, IL, OH, SC, WY, AL, MI, ME, NC, SD, DE, MA, NE, ND, IA, NH, NM, MT, ID, MS, DC, AK and the countries of Canada and Australia.

What You Should Do

Consumers should contact the recalling firm for further instructions regarding the software update.

Why This Matters

The Class II recall addresses a defect that may cause temporary or reversible adverse health consequences.
